Warning Signs You Need Truck-Mounted Water Extraction

Identifying the signs of water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th or standing water.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s crucial to inspect the underlying materials and address any issues quickly.

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ceiling

St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can show water damage. If you notice any unusual marks or discoloration,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your walls or ceiling,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Swollen or Discolored Wood

Swollen or discolored wood can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your wood trim or furniture, it’s crucial to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ost in Rockwall, TX

Estimating the cost of truck-mounted water extraction can be challenging, as prices v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Rockwall, TX. But, here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Depends on the complexity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Depends on the amount of water extracted and the equipment required.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ment required.
Mold Remediation $500 – $2,500 Depends on the severity of the mold growth and the equipment required.
Final Inspection and Restoration $100 – $500 Depends on the complexity of the repairs and the materials required.
Emergency Service Fee (after hours or weekends) $100 – $500 Depends on the time of day and the complexity of the emergency.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of truck-mounted water extraction may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a free consultation and estimate to help you understand the costs involved.

Common Questions About Truck-Mounted Water Extraction

What is the typical response time for emergency water extraction services in Rockwall, TX?

We respond to emergency water extraction calls within 60 minutes, depending on the location and availability of our technicians. Our team is on standby 24/7 to provide immediate help.

How long does it take to extract water from a flooded basement?

The time it takes to extract water from a flooded basement depends on the amount of water and the equipment required. On average, it can take anywhere from 1-5 hours to extract water from a small to medium-sized basement.

Why do I need to dry the affected area after water extraction?

Drying the affected area after water extraction is crucial to prevent mold growth and further damage.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ry the area quickly and efficiently, ensuring that it’s safe for you to return to your property.

Can I perform water extraction myself with a wet/dry vacuum?

We don’t recommend performing water extraction yourself with a wet/dry vacuum. While it may seem like a quick fix, improper extraction can lead to further damage and create more problems than it solves. Our team has the necessary equipment and expertise to extract water safely and effectively.

How do you ensure that the affected area is completely dry?

We use specialized equipment, including mo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ras, to ensure that the affected area is completely dry. Our team will also conduct a final inspection to verify that the area is dry and safe for you to return to your property.
